The Company: An opportunity for a Merchandiser/ Product Developer to join an established supplier to the High Street Retailers. Hybrid options available.
The Role:
- Motivated, enthusiastic and have a drive to push sales (identify sales opportunities)
- Ability to handle pressure and deadlines
- Manage current departments and generate new business leads
- Fast paced and on the ball
- Knowledge on trends / Licenses and garment construction would be an advantage
- Efficient
- Respond and engage to new order enquiries
- Excellent communication skills as working directly with the customers/ hubs / factories
- Be able to negotiate prices with factories via Turkey to meet customer targets and close orders
- Work closely with designers and merchandise teams to present solutions to customer to simplify design and maintain a good overall sales price
- Working closely with the merchandise team & problem solving issues to avoid discounts
- Team player and able to build strong customer relations and with factories
- Confirm costings and delivery dates with customer
- Aim to learn the PLM (Product Lifecycle Management) System
- Chase sample developments with the in country teams and feedback to customer on status
- Have experience to manage development critical path, updating and chasing daily for approvals
- Providing customer with weekly updates through Critical path document
- Arrange samples in house to post to buying teams
- Confident to offer new products to the customer
- Admin heavy based role so must be well organised
Skills Required:
- Experience of working in ladies or childrenswear, jersey or knitted products is advantageous.
- Must understand costings.
- Excellent communication skills both written and verbal.
- Fully computer literate.
